The global shipping industry is increasingly turning to artificial intelligence (AI) to improve safety and prevent cargo-related fire incidents. With millions of containers transported annually, even a single fire can cause significant economic losses, environmental damage, and endanger lives. Traditional monitoring methods often rely on manual inspections, which may fail to identify high-risk cargo in time.
AI-powered systems analyze real-time data from sensors, temperature readings, smoke detectors, and cargo manifests to detect early signs of potential fire hazards. These intelligent solutions can identify flammable materials, improper packing, or overheating equipment, allowing shipping companies to take preventive action before an incident occurs.
Major ports and shipping operators are now integrating AI tools into their logistics workflows, enabling predictive maintenance and automated alerts for high-risk containers. This proactive approach not only enhances fire safety but also improves overall operational efficiency by reducing delays and minimizing damage to goods.
Experts emphasize that AI is not a replacement for traditional fire safety measures but a complementary tool that strengthens risk management. By combining advanced technology with established safety protocols, the shipping industry can better safeguard personnel, cargo, and the environment, ultimately making global shipping safer and more reliable.
